技术文摘
MySQL 开发规范及使用技巧汇总
MySQL 开发规范及使用技巧汇总
在当今的软件开发领域,MySQL 作为一种广泛使用的关系型数据库管理系统,掌握其开发规范和使用技巧对于提高数据库性能、确保数据的准确性和完整性以及提升开发效率至关重要。
开发规范方面,首先要合理设计数据库表结构。确保表字段的数据类型选择恰当,避免过度浪费存储空间。为表设置合适的主键和索引,以提高数据查询的效率。在命名上,遵循统一且具有描述性的命名规则,使表名、字段名清晰易懂。
数据的完整性约束也不能忽视。通过设置非空约束、唯一约束和外键约束等,保证数据的准确性和一致性。要注意避免冗余数据的出现,以保持数据库的简洁和高效。
在使用技巧方面,善于运用 SQL 语句的优化技巧能带来显著的效果。例如,尽量避免在查询中使用 SELECT *,而是明确指定所需的字段。对于复杂的查询,可以考虑使用临时表或视图来简化逻辑。
合理使用存储过程和函数可以提高代码的复用性和执行效率。在存储过程中,通过封装一系列的操作,减少网络传输开销。
对于大数据量的处理,要懂得分表和分区的策略。分表可以将数据分散到多个表中,分区则是在单个表内按照一定规则进行划分,从而提高数据的读写性能。
在数据备份和恢复方面,定期进行完整备份,并结合增量备份,以保障数据的安全性。同时,要熟悉恢复数据的操作流程,以便在出现问题时能够快速恢复。
另外,关注 MySQL 的性能指标和日志信息,及时发现潜在的问题并进行优化调整。例如,通过慢查询日志找出执行效率低下的 SQL 语句,进而进行针对性的优化。
遵循 MySQL 的开发规范,灵活运用使用技巧,能够充分发挥 MySQL 的优势,为应用程序提供稳定、高效的数据存储和管理支持。
TAGS: Mysql 相关 MySQL 开发规范 MySQL 使用技巧 MySQL 汇总
- Windows Server 系统休眠无法唤醒的解决之道
- 如何卸载打印机驱动?教程来了
- Win11 蓝牙图标消失的解决之道
- Win7 安装 VMware Tools 失败的解决之道
- Win11 显示器左右黑边及桌面左侧深色框的解决之法
- Win10 粘滞键无法关闭的解决之道
- Win10 内存诊断的操作步骤
- 微软发布 KB5036082 与 KB5036080 使 Win11 版本号升至 26058.1×00
- Win11 Canary 26063 预览版更新发布:支持 Wi-Fi 7 测试 新增 16 项 AI 技能
- Win10 驱动加载失败的原因及解决措施
- Win10 卸载 Edge 浏览器出现错误代码 0x800f0922 需注意
- Win10 索引选项修改按钮无法使用的解决之道
- Win11 检测工具安装不了如何处理?解决 Win11 检测工具安装失败的方法
- 微软:符合条件的 Win11 设备将自动升级至 23H2 并附禁止升级技巧
- PS2023 与 Win11 的兼容性及安装图文教程